3:30.There was a serious recalibration on Friday at the Australian PGA
Championship, the morning after lightning and rain prevented any play late on
the first day. Varner and Poulter were among the players who didnt finish their
first rounds before the postponement, and had to be back at Royal Pines Resort
to tee off at 5:30 a.m. on FridayI cant just get up and feel good. Ive got to
stretch, said Varner, who was runner-up here last year after losing a three-way
playoff. I dont like to just get up and go. I like to chill.Varner had a share
of second spot at 5 under after 14 holes when his first round was interrupted on
Thursday. He finished off with a couple of birdies for an opening 65, and a
share of the lead at 7 under. His second round followed quickly, and he had a
birdie on the 12th -- the third hole of his second round -- to move to 8
under.Double bogeys on the 15th and 16th were setbacks. He had a birdie at the
18th, then a bogey at the 2nd, before finishing with three birdies in his last
five holes to card an even second round and remain at 7 under, good enough to
keep him up near the top of the leaderboard.The 15th, 16th ... happened real
fast, he said. It was just a bad combination. I hit some bad shots and I
compounded those with my attitude.Then I also used that attitude to get out of
there. I made enough birdies ... it was nice to rebound, finish really

the AL wild-card race. A letter drafted by U.S. and Canadian anti-doping leaders
urging Russias removal from the upcoming Olympics is circulating days before the
public release of a report expected to detail a state-sponsored doping system
that corrupted the countrys entire sports program.The letter, drafted last week
and obtained by The Associated Press, is being prepared to be sent to the
International Olympic Committees president and executive board after the Monday
release of a report by investigator Richard McLaren.The letter calls for the IOC
to act by July 26 to ensure that Russias Olympic Committee and sports
federations will not be allowed in Rio de Janeiro, where the Games are set to
start Aug. 5. The letter encourages exceptions for Russia-born athletes who can
prove they were subject to strong anti-doping systems in other countries.A
statement from Pat Hickey, the president of the European Olympic Committee, said
the letter undermined the integrity and therefore the credibility of this
important report.My concern is that there seems to have been an attempt to agree
(on) an outcome before any evidence has been presented, Hickey said.USADA CEO
Travis Tygart said the letter, which has backing from anti-doping agencies in a
number of countries and athlete groups from around the world, was drafted with
no intent for it to become public unless the McLaren report contains evidence of
a major state-sponsored doping program.Of course, we want and hope for universal
inclusion, but were not blind to the evidence already out there, Tygart said.
And if were not preparing for all potential outcomes, then we are not fulfilling
our promise to clean athletes.The McLaren report was sparked by a New York Times
story that accused the Russian government of helping to manipulate tests at the
Sochi Games so cheaters wouldnt get caught.Preliminary findings from the report,
released last month, found mandatory state-directed manipulation of laboratory
analytical results operating within the Moscow anti-doping lab from at least
2011 through the summer of 2013. Those findings also said Russias Ministry of
Sport adviised the laboratory which of its adverse findings it could report to
WADA, and which it had to cover up.
